947,196 is a composite number, even.
947,196 (nine hundred forty-seven thousand one hundred ninety-six) is an even 6-digit number. It is a composite number with 36 divisors, and factors as 2² × 3² × 83 × 317. Its proper divisors sum to 1,483,596,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xE73FC.
